* [StGIT PATCH] Do not mess-up with commit message formatting when sending email

The short description, which will be used as the email subject,
gets its leading and trailing whitespaces removed.

The long description only gets its trailing whitespaces removed
to preserve commit message formatting, e.g. in the case of a
ChangeLog-style commit message, as well as empty leading lines.

diff --git a/stgit/commands/mail.py b/stgit/commands/mail.py
index a833efc..bdc3fcc 100644
--- a/stgit/commands/mail.py
+++ b/stgit/commands/mail.py
@@ -401,8 +401,8 @@ def __build_message(tmpl, patch, patch_nr, total_nr, msg_id, ref_id, options):
         options.edit_patches = True
 
     descr_lines = descr.split('\n')
-    short_descr = descr_lines[0].rstrip()
-    long_descr = '\n'.join(descr_lines[1:]).lstrip()
+    short_descr = descr_lines[0].strip()
+    long_descr = '\n'.join([l.rstrip() for l in descr_lines[1:]]).lstrip('\n')
 
     authname = p.get_authname();
     authemail = p.get_authemail();
